Bug#568086: xorg: suspend/resume issues since squeeze upgrade 2010-01-28



Package: xorg
Version: 1:7.5+3
Severity: important

Since the recent upgrade, I have resume issues on my Eee PC 1000HG:

driver "intel":  After resume display flickers from time to time (maybe every
2-5 minutes), after a couple of hours of flickering it goes white (most of the
times) or blue (observed only once so far).  This can be reproduced reliably.

driver "vesa":  Backlight was off on resume, could be switched on with Fn-F6,
however console (Ctrl-Alt-F1) was botched, too, showing a full screen of Euro
signs (€).  Didn't try to reproduce.

Xorg.log is attached showing one suspend/resume cycle with the intel driver.

Let me know, if you need more info.
